Payment card security compliance changed shape in 2025. PCI DSS v4.0.1 is now the only valid version of the standard, and as of 31 March 2025, every requirement it contains — including a set of provisions that were originally future-dated — is mandatory. There is no longer a “we’ll get to that requirement later” grace period. If your organization stores, processes, or transmits cardholder data, this is the standard you are held to today, in full.

What PCI DSS Covers and Who Must Comply
PCI DSS (Payment Card Industry Data Security Standard) is a security standard maintained by the PCI Security Standards Council, a body created by the major card brands — Visa, Mastercard, American Express, Discover, and JCB. It is important to be precise about what that means: PCI DSS is not a government regulation. It is a contractual requirement, enforced through your merchant agreement with your acquiring bank and, ultimately, through the card brands themselves. Non-compliance does not bring a government fine — it brings contractual penalties, higher transaction fees, and in serious cases the loss of your ability to accept card payments at all.
The standard applies to any entity that stores, processes, or transmits cardholder data (the primary account number, and in some flows the cardholder name, expiration date, and service code) or sensitive authentication data (full magnetic stripe data, CVV/CVC codes, PINs). That scope is broad by design:
- Merchants of any size that accept card payments, online or in person.
- Payment processors and gateways that route or handle transactions on a merchant’s behalf.
- Service providers that store, process, or transmit cardholder data for another organization — this includes many SaaS platforms, hosting providers, and call centers that touch card data incidentally.
- Their vendors and sub-processors, if cardholder data flows through them.
A common and costly mistake is assuming that outsourcing payment processing to a third party (Stripe, Adyen, a hosted checkout page) removes you from scope entirely. It reduces scope — often substantially — but it rarely eliminates it. If your systems ever touch, store, or influence the handling of cardholder data, you retain some PCI DSS obligation, even if it is a lighter-weight SAQ.
The 12 Requirements at a Glance
PCI DSS organizes its controls into 12 top-level requirements, grouped into six control objectives. The requirement numbers have stayed consistent across versions, which is why practitioners still refer to “Requirement 3” or “Requirement 11” as shorthand years after the standard has otherwise changed underneath them.
- Install and maintain network security controls — firewalls and equivalent controls between untrusted networks and the cardholder data environment (CDE).
- Apply secure configurations to all system components — no vendor-default passwords or unnecessary services.
- Protect stored account data — encryption, truncation, masking, or tokenization of stored cardholder data; strict limits on retention.
- Protect cardholder data with strong cryptography during transmission over open, public networks.
- Protect all systems and networks from malicious software — anti-malware controls, kept current.
- Develop and maintain secure systems and software — secure development practices, including protections for payment pages and scripts against tampering (a requirement significantly strengthened in v4.0.1 in response to e-skimming attacks).
- Restrict access to system components and cardholder data by business need to know — least privilege as a baseline, not an aspiration.
- Identify users and authenticate access to system components — including multi-factor authentication requirements that expanded meaningfully under v4.0.1.
- Restrict physical access to cardholder data — physical security controls for media, devices, and facilities.
- Log and monitor all access to system components and cardholder data — centralized, reviewed logging, with v4.0.1 pushing toward automated log review rather than manual spot checks.
- Test the security of systems and networks regularly — vulnerability scanning (including mandatory quarterly external scans by an Approved Scanning Vendor), and penetration testing.
- Support information security with organizational policies and programs — the governance layer: documented policy, risk assessment, incident response, and a formal security awareness program.
Version 4.0.1 did not renumber or replace these 12 requirements — the headline change is underneath them. There are now roughly 500 sub-requirements across the 12 domains, and the new material clusters around six themes: payment page and script integrity (Requirement 6), stronger authentication (Requirement 8), automated log review (Requirement 10), more rigorous vulnerability management (Requirement 11), tighter scope-definition discipline, and a shift toward formalized, ongoing risk analysis rather than a once-a-year checklist exercise.
Compliance Levels by Transaction Volume
Not every organization in scope for PCI DSS is validated the same way. The card brands assign a merchant level based on annual transaction volume across all channels, and that level determines how rigorously — and how independently — compliance must be validated.
| Level | Annual transaction volume | Typical validation |
|---|---|---|
| Level 1 | Over 6,000,000 transactions annually (all channels) | Annual on-site assessment by a QSA, producing a Report on Compliance (ROC) |
| Level 2 | 1,000,000 – 6,000,000 transactions annually | Annual Self-Assessment Questionnaire (SAQ); some card brands require a QSA-led assessment |
| Level 3 | 20,000 – 1,000,000 e-commerce transactions annually | Annual SAQ |
| Level 4 | Under 20,000 e-commerce transactions annually, or up to 1,000,000 total transactions across all channels | Annual SAQ (requirements vary by acquirer) |
Two caveats matter more than the table itself. First, your acquiring bank has the final say on your level and validation requirements — the thresholds above are the common industry framing, but an acquirer can require stricter validation than volume alone would suggest, particularly after a breach. Second, all levels can be required to run quarterly external vulnerability scans through an Approved Scanning Vendor (ASV), regardless of whether the rest of validation is a self-assessment or a full audit. Volume determines the depth of the audit; it does not exempt anyone from ongoing technical testing.
The Assessment Process (SAQ vs QSA)
The two validation paths differ in who performs the assessment and how much independent scrutiny it carries.
Self-Assessment Questionnaire (SAQ). This is the path for most Level 2–4 merchants. It is a structured questionnaire — there are multiple SAQ types (A, A-EP, B, C, D, and others) depending on how your organization handles cardholder data, and choosing the wrong SAQ type is one of the most common compliance mistakes. A fully outsourced, hosted-checkout e-commerce merchant with no cardholder data touching its own systems might qualify for the lightest SAQ type; a merchant that processes card data directly on its own servers will land on the most comprehensive one. The SAQ is self-validated — your organization attests to its own compliance — but that does not make it optional or low-stakes: a false attestation carries real contractual and reputational risk if a breach later reveals the attestation was inaccurate.
Qualified Security Assessor (QSA) assessment. Level 1 merchants (and some Level 2 merchants, depending on the card brand and acquirer) require an independent, formal assessment conducted by a QSA — an individual certified by the PCI Security Standards Council to perform PCI DSS assessments. The QSA reviews evidence, tests controls, and produces a Report on Compliance (ROC), a much more detailed document than an SAQ attestation. Some organizations with the internal expertise and independence can instead complete an Internal Security Assessor (ISA)-led assessment, but this is the exception rather than the rule.
A structural point that is easy to miss: PCI DSS v4.0.1 explicitly frames compliance as continuous, not annual. The assessment — SAQ or ROC — is a point-in-time snapshot, but the underlying expectation is that controls are operating and documented year-round. “We assembled the evidence the week before the audit” is precisely the pattern the standard is designed to catch and increasingly does, through requirements like automated (rather than manual, periodic) log review.
PCI DSS Alongside ISO 27001 or SOC 2
Organizations that already carry an ISO 27001 certification or a SOC 2 report often ask whether PCI DSS is redundant on top of that work. It is not redundant, but it is substantially reusable.
The overlap is real: all three frameworks expect a documented risk assessment process, formal access control, security logging and monitoring, incident response procedures, and oversight of third-party vendors. If your ISO 27001 Information Security Management System (ISMS) or your SOC 2 control environment is mature, a meaningful share of that evidence — policies, risk registers, access review records, vendor due-diligence documentation — maps directly onto PCI DSS Requirement 12 (organizational policy) and Requirement 7/8 (access and authentication).
Where PCI DSS diverges is specificity. ISO 27001 and SOC 2 are largely control-objective frameworks: they tell you what outcome to achieve and leave the technical implementation to you. PCI DSS is far more prescriptive about the how for anything touching cardholder data — specific encryption requirements for stored data, mandatory network segmentation for the cardholder data environment, quarterly external scanning cadence, and detailed rules about what can and cannot be stored (full magnetic stripe data and CVV codes, for example, can never be stored post-authorization, full stop). An organization should treat PCI DSS as a card-data-scoped overlay on top of a broader compliance program, mapped against frameworks like GDPR, ISO 27001, and SOC 2 in a multi-framework governance program, rather than a separate program built from scratch.
The Practical Takeaway
Three things matter more than memorizing the requirement numbers. First, know your actual cardholder data footprint — most organizations either overestimate their scope (and pay for controls they do not need) or underestimate it (and carry undocumented risk) because nobody has mapped where card data actually flows. Second, treat validation as a snapshot of a program that runs continuously, not a project that starts a month before the deadline. Third, if you already run ISO 27001 or SOC 2, build PCI DSS as an addition to that governance structure rather than a parallel one — the redundant effort of maintaining two disconnected compliance programs is where most of the wasted cost in this space actually comes from.
